Output 828f32d6b226a370d8da5d688e612d7af2b588405a1e8c1622577a709edce521:3

value
309896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aae97534abba68ea239ca990463b2323d637a93 OP_EQUAL
address
3BR6hgTTELEHrpfoApBH2smyhN8vTnziCA
transaction
828f32d6b226a370d8da5d688e612d7af2b588405a1e8c1622577a709edce521
spent
true